Our Exterior Car Wash Process

1.

In order for us to wash car paint without scratching or marring, the surface must be cleared from large dirt particles. This is done by spraying a sheet of cleansing foam onto the vehicle that is left to dwell for a couple of minutes.  Our chemicals lift dirt off the paint where we can safely spray it down, working from the top to the bottom of the vehicle.

2.

There will always be some degree of dirt that a touchless wash cannot get off your vehicle. This is why a mechanical wash is necessary--it removes left over dirt. We use a foam cannon to apply another sheet of foam which will gives our wash mitts added lubricity lowering the chances of scratching even further. After every panel is clean from top to bottom, we spray all the soap away with a high-flow rate pressure washer.

3.

Depending on the detailing package, a clay bar may be used, but only after the hand wash step is completed. If your paint feels rough while you run your fingers over it, there are embedded contaminants in your paint that a wash mitt cannot remove; a clay bar treatment easily removes these embedded contaminants.

4.

Without marring the car's paint, a synthetic clay bar will pull embedded break dust, industrial fallout, and dirt stuck in the paint's pores. Lubricant is sprayed onto the paint as the bar is scrubbed accross the surface; without lubrication, we run the risk of adding small scratches to the paint. After our clay bar service, the paint no longer looks dull, but instead the paint now glows.

Our detailing protocol for extreme heat or extreme cold:

  • !
    1. We rotate our chemical arsenal to "rinse-less wash" chemicals. These are designed in a way that allows for them to dry or freeze without damaging paint. Central Florida heat can get so strong the chemicals begin to evaporate within seconds.  Our team takes the necessary steps to ensure every car's paint is safe.
  • !
    2. Working panel by panel keeps things efficient and clear. Each panel gets sprayed with rinse-less wash, then gently wiped with a microfiber, and optionally a clay bar is used after the major contaminants are removed. The non-marring clay bar requires lubrication to ensure no scratches form. We simply apply a more concentrated coating of rinse-less wash before the clay bar makes contact with the paint.
  • !
    3. Extreme heat and cold does not allow us to spray our wax or sealant (depending on the detailing package) because they will dry or freeze. Our compromise is to spray the coating onto a microfiber and apply it by hand; it is important to immediatly wipe up the excess coating to prevent too much from drying on the surface.

What is the hardest part of washing the car's exterior?

Bugs, brake dust, and road tar embedded in the car's front grille are the toughest debris to clean off.  Occasionally, depending on road conditions, these contaminants embed themselves in your paint.  Once they are embedded, a hand wash will not remove them unless a clay bar is used.
